The Bachelor of Arts / Bachelor of Laws at Australian Catholic University has a duration of 260 weeks (approximately 5 years), as listed on the CRICOS registry.
The estimated total course cost is AU$184,000, comprising entirely of tuition fees, with no additional non-tuition fees listed.
Yes, the Bachelor of Arts / Bachelor of Laws includes a work component of 5 hours per week over 64 weeks, totalling 320 hours across the duration of the course.
The course is available at four campuses: the North Sydney Campus (NSW), Strathfield Campus (NSW), Brisbane Campus (QLD), and Melbourne Campus (VIC), all owned and operated by Australian Catholic University.
This dual qualification covers two fields of education: the first qualification falls under Society and Culture (Broad Field 09, detailed as Society and Culture n.e.c.), and the second qualification falls under Law (Narrow Field 0909, detailed as Law n.e.c.).
